Prawns in Garlic and Chilli Sauce


Features of Prawns in Garlic and Chilli Sauce

Served as main course. Non-vegetarian dish. Speciality: A cuisine for Durga Puja / Sharodiya festival

Region of Prawns in Garlic and Chilli Sauce

Indian

Ingredients for Prawns in Garlic and Chilli Sauce   (Click here for measurement conversion)

1 kg uncooked King Prawns

3 cloves Garlic, crushed

2 teaspoons Sugar

1 teaspoon Soy Sauce

1/2 teaspoon Sesame Oil

2 Tablespoons Cornflour

5 Tablespoons Oil

2 Tablespoons Oyster Sauce

2 Tablespoons Water

1 Tablespoon Ginger Wine

1 Tablespoon Chilli Sauce

1 Tablespoon Tomato Sauce

1 large Onion, chopped

1 green or red Capsicum, chopped

2 Spring Onions, chopped

Method for making Prawns in Garlic and Chilli Sauce

Peel prawns leaving tails intact, and remove back veins. Combine prawns in a bowl with garlic, sugar, soy sauce, sesame oil and 1 tablespoon of the corn flour. Mix well, and let stand for 10 minutes. Heat 4 tablespoons of oil in a frying pan and fry prawns for 5 minutes. Remove from heat. Combine remaining 1 tablespoon corn flour with oyster sauce, water, ginger wine, chilli sauce and tomato sauce. Heat remaining 1 tablespoon oil in a saucepan, sauté onion and capsicum for 2 minutes. Add prawns and cornflour mixture, stir over heat 5 minutes or until sauce has thickened. Add spring onions.
